Business Analytics is the process of leveraging data, statistical analysis, and quantitative methods to extract insights and make informed decisions in a business setting. It involves the use of various analytical techniques, such as data mining, predictive modeling, and data visualization, to interpret historical data and predict future trends. By understanding the relationships between different variables and identifying patterns, businesses can optimize their operations, improve efficiency, and gain a competitive edge in the market.

A proficient Business Analytics expert should possess a combination of technical and soft skills. Technical competencies include proficiency in data analysis tools, statistical knowledge, data manipulation, and programming skills (e.g., Python, R, SQL). Soft skills like critical thinking, problem-solving, communication, and business acumen are equally crucial to effectively interpret and communicate analytical insights to stakeholders.

Yes, Business Analytics involves a significant amount of mathematics. Analyzing data, creating predictive models, and interpreting results require mathematical concepts like probability, statistics, linear algebra, and calculus. Proficiency in these areas enables Business Analysts to make data-driven decisions and solve complex business problems.

While both Business Analysts and Data Analysts work with data, their focus and responsibilities differ. Business Analysts primarily concentrate on understanding business needs, identifying opportunities for improvement, and providing insights to support decision-making. On the other hand, Data Analysts focus on data cleansing, visualization, and statistical analysis to extract meaningful information from datasets.

The essential building blocks of business analytics include data collection, data cleaning and preparation, data analysis and modeling, data visualization, and communicating insights. These steps form a structured approach to extract meaningful information from data and convert it into actionable knowledge for businesses.

The journey of Business Analytics traces back to the early use of statistical methods for quality control in manufacturing during the 1920s. Over time, advancements in technology, computing power, and data collection techniques have led to the evolution of Business Analytics as a comprehensive field. Today, it plays a vital role in transforming businesses by harnessing data to drive innovation, efficiency, and strategic planning.

Classification of analytics includes descriptive analytics (understanding past events), diagnostic analytics (identifying reasons for outcomes), predictive analytics (forecasting future events), prescriptive analytics (offering recommended actions), text analytics (extracting insights from text data), spatial analytics (analyzing geographic data), network analytics (studying relationships in a network), and more. Each type serves different purposes and helps businesses and data scientists make data-driven decisions and gain valuable insights.
